Building Blocks, Cohort Genetic Algorithms, and Hyperplane-Defined Functions

Building blocks are a ubiquitous feature at all levels of human understanding, from perception through science and innovation. Genetic algorithms are designed to exploit this prevalence. A new, more robust class of genetic algorithms, cohort genetic algorithms (cGA's), provides substantial advantages in exploring search spaces for building blocks while exploiting building blocks already found. To test these capabilities, a new, general class of test functions, the hyperplane-defined functions (hdf's), has been designed. Hdf's offer the means of tracing the origin of each advance in performance; at the same time hdf's are resistant to reverse engineering, so that algorithms cannot be designed to take advantage of the characteristics of particular examples.

[1]  John R. Koza,et al.  Hidden Order: How Adaptation Builds Complexity. , 1995, Artificial Life.

[2]  L. Darrell Whitley,et al.  Evaluating Evolutionary Algorithms , 1996, Artif. Intell..

[3]  H. Hutter,et al.  Conservation and novelty in the evolution of cell adhesion and extracellular matrix genes. , 2000, Science.

[4]  R. Punnett,et al.  The Genetical Theory of Natural Selection , 1930, Nature.

[5]  John H. Holland,et al.  Hidden Order: How Adaptation Builds Complexity , 1995 .

[6]  John H. Holland,et al.  Adaptation in Natural and Artificial Systems: An Introductory Analysis with Applications to Biology, Control, and Artificial Intelligence , 1992 .

[7]  R. Keenan,et al.  SRP--Where the RNA and Membrane Worlds Meet , 2000, Science.

[8]  Marcus W. Feldman,et al.  Algorithms, genetics, and populations: The schemata theorem revisited , 1998, Complex..

[9]  M. Vose The Simple Genetic Algorithm , 1999 .

[10]  J. H. Holland,et al.  On Iterative Circuit Computers Constructed of Microelectronic Components and Systems , 1899 .

[11]  Eric S. Lander,et al.  Journey to the Center of Biology , 2000, Science.

[12]  Dorothea Heiss-Czedik,et al.  An Introduction to Genetic Algorithms. , 1997, Artificial Life.

[13]  M. R. Adams,et al.  Comparative genomics of the eukaryotes. , 2000, Science.

[14]  Melanie Mitchell,et al.  The royal road for genetic algorithms: Fitness landscapes and GA performance , 1991 .

[15]  Theodore C. Belding,et al.  Potholes on the Royal Road , 2001, ArXiv.

[16]  K. Pienta,et al.  Modeling signal transduction in normal and cancer cells using complex adaptive systems. , 1997, Medical hypotheses.

[17]  Michael D. Vose,et al.  The simple genetic algorithm - foundations and theory , 1999, Complex adaptive systems.